Strategy ONE

常见问题

请参阅以下您可能遇到的问题以及避免这些问题的最佳做法。

问题背景太复杂,难以处理

当您向自动答复提交问题时,有可能在返回答案之前达到数据输入限制。如果发生这种情况,您会收到以下响应:仪表板定义太大,无法使用自动,请在重试之前优化数据集和仪表板。

有多种因素会影响问题的权重:

  • 仪表板、仪表板页面或数据集中的对象数量。

  • 语义图的名称。对象名称中的单词数量会影响问题的复杂性。

最佳实践

  • 作者应该在发布之前检查自动应答的功能和性能,并考虑用户会问的常见业务案例和典型问题。

  • 作者应该通过审查、降低复杂性和内容密度来简化自动答案的数据集。作者应该采用清晰的命名约定并创建数据集的更轻版本,以增强用户使用自动答案的可用性。

  • 用户可以将问题的范围限制在页面上显示的内容内。

多个问题

如果您在一个问题中向自动答案提出多个问题,则答案可能只回答一个问题、部分回答两个问题或误解该问题。

例如,如果您问“哪家商店的收入最高,哪个产品类别的利润率最低?”,自动答案可能会准确地识别出收入最高的商店,但可能无法解决利润率问题。

最佳实践

避免在一个问题中提出多个问题。每次只关注一个问题,问题越具体,结果越准确。

回答不可聚合的值

即使您使用准确表述的问题,有时仍会遇到自动答案的意外回应。这通常是由于某些度量定义和聚合函数而发生的。当指标不是为动态聚合而设计的并且被查询时,最终的计算可能会导致误导性、错误或空值。例如,当查询某个指标(如年度人口数据)而没有指定必要的维度(例如年份)时,可能会出现随时间推移的数据不准确的聚合。

例如,如果问题没有考虑年份,自动答案的答复将产生偏差的结果,并将数据集中所有年份的人口值相加。下图左侧显示正确值,右侧显示错误值:

最佳实践

为了准确响应包含不可聚合值的查询,请使用基于以下各项的非聚合指标:Strategy仪表板中的项目模式。库存计算等非汇总指标在零售垂直行业或银行业中很普遍。在由项目模式支持的应用程序中,自动答案会在正确的聚合级别处理指标,并尊重定义的不可聚合设置,以提供可靠和准确的答案。

例如,如果您问“2020 年 12 月,Discman 的期末库存水平是多少?”,自动答案将正确提供月末库存,而无需汇总前几个月的库存。